23春《web應(yīng)用開(kāi)發(fā)》作業(yè)1-00001
試卷總分:100 得分:100
一、單選題 (共 10 道試題,共 40 分)
1.在HTML中顯示圖像使用下面哪個(gè)標(biāo)簽()。
A.<select>
B.<input>
C.<div>
D.<img>
2.Internet上提供的主要服務(wù)有:Telnet、E-mail、()、FTP。
A.App
B.Windows
C.WWW
D.W3C。
3.負(fù)責(zé)IP地址與域名之間轉(zhuǎn)換的是()。
A.UNIX系統(tǒng)
B.FTP系統(tǒng)
C.WINDOWS NT系統(tǒng)
D.DNS域名系統(tǒng)。
4.Jinja2模板中變量可以通過(guò)()進(jìn)行修改。
A.內(nèi)置函數(shù)
B.過(guò)濾器
C.渲染
D.模板。
5.URL的組成格式為()。
A.資源類(lèi)型、存放資源的主機(jī)域名和資源文件名
B.資源類(lèi)型、資源文件名和存放資源的主機(jī)域名
C.主機(jī)域名、資源類(lèi)型、資源文件名
D.資源文件名、主機(jī)域名、資源類(lèi)型。
6.Flask中用于請(qǐng)求解析的對(duì)象是()。
A.Requests
B.Request
C.Response
D.Header
7.在HTTP協(xié)議的“請(qǐng)求/響應(yīng)”交互模型中,以下說(shuō)法中錯(cuò)誤的是()。
A.客戶(hù)機(jī)在發(fā)送請(qǐng)求之前需要主動(dòng)與服務(wù)器建立連接
B.服務(wù)器無(wú)法主動(dòng)向客戶(hù)機(jī)發(fā)起連接
C.服務(wù)器無(wú)法主動(dòng)向客戶(hù)機(jī)發(fā)送數(shù)據(jù)
D.以上都錯(cuò)
8.下列關(guān)于Session的描述中,錯(cuò)誤的是()。
A.Session存儲(chǔ)在服務(wù)端
B.大量的Session會(huì)對(duì)服務(wù)端內(nèi)存造成壓力
C.Session可以在多個(gè)服務(wù)器之間共享
D.通常下Cookie比Session安全。
9.下面哪一個(gè)擴(kuò)展可以實(shí)現(xiàn)發(fā)送郵件功能()。
A.Flask-Mail
B.Flask-Script
C.Flask-SQLAlchemy
D.Flask-Migrate
10.Web程序要想順利運(yùn)行,就需要Web服務(wù)器、瀏覽器、()三者相互配合,共同發(fā)揮作用。
A.數(shù)據(jù)庫(kù)
B.HTML
C.網(wǎng)頁(yè)
D.通信協(xié)議。
二、多選題 (共 5 道試題,共 20 分)
11.關(guān)于Web服務(wù)器,下列描述正確的是()。
A.互聯(lián)網(wǎng)上的一臺(tái)特殊功能的計(jì)算機(jī),給互聯(lián)網(wǎng)的用戶(hù)提供WWW服務(wù)
B.Web服務(wù)器上必須安裝Web服務(wù)器軟件
C.asp網(wǎng)頁(yè)可以在任何一臺(tái)計(jì)算機(jī)上運(yùn)行
D.當(dāng)用戶(hù)瀏覽Web服務(wù)器上的網(wǎng)頁(yè)的時(shí)候,使用的是C/S工作方式。
12.以下關(guān)于Flask框架中的模板引擎,描述正確的是()。
A.模板是一個(gè)包含兩種類(lèi)型的數(shù)據(jù)的文件
B.Flask利用Jinja2模板引擎
C.開(kāi)發(fā)人員可以使用帶有占位符的HTML模板來(lái)創(chuàng)建動(dòng)態(tài)數(shù)據(jù)
D.它消除了編寫(xiě)復(fù)雜SQL查詢(xún)的需要
13.MVC的組成部分是()。
A.模型
B.視圖
C.控制器
D.地址
14.Python三大Web框架是()。
A.Flask
B.Django
C.Tornado
D.Mysql。
15.表單由三個(gè)部分組成:()。
A.表單標(biāo)簽
B.表單域
C.表單按鈕
D.表單數(shù)據(jù)
三、判斷題 (共 10 道試題,共 40 分)
16.Flask類(lèi)的構(gòu)造函數(shù)只有一個(gè)必須指定的參數(shù),即程序主模塊或包的名字。
17.Flask原生不支持?jǐn)?shù)據(jù)庫(kù)訪(fǎng)問(wèn)、Web表單驗(yàn)證和用戶(hù)身份驗(yàn)證等高級(jí)功能。
18.Web應(yīng)用具有狀態(tài)保持能力。
19.Internet是一個(gè)超級(jí)互聯(lián)網(wǎng),它是將遍布于全球的計(jì)算機(jī)網(wǎng)絡(luò)互聯(lián)而成的網(wǎng)絡(luò)。
20.Flask調(diào)用視圖函數(shù)后,會(huì)將其返回值作為相應(yīng)的內(nèi)容。
21.HTTP協(xié)議只是HTTP客戶(hù)機(jī)程序和HTTP服務(wù)器之間的通信協(xié)議。
22.Jinja2是Flask作者開(kāi)發(fā)的一個(gè)模板系統(tǒng),為Flask提供模板支持。
23.模板是一個(gè)包含響應(yīng)文本的文件,其中包含用占位變量表示的動(dòng)態(tài)部分,其具體值只在請(qǐng)求的上下文中才能知道。
24.HTTP的連接很簡(jiǎn)單,是無(wú)狀態(tài)的。
25.Flask-WTF及其依賴(lài)可使用pip安裝: (venv) $ pip install flask-wtf。
奧鵬,國(guó)開(kāi),廣開(kāi),電大在線(xiàn),各省平臺(tái),新疆一體化等平臺(tái)學(xué)習(xí)
詳情請(qǐng)咨詢(xún)QQ : 3230981406或微信:aopopenfd777

